What to Ask LPN and LVN Programs

Lawrence Kansas LPN holding patient fileOnce you have decided on obtaining your LPN or LVN certificate or degree, and if you will attend classes on campus or on the internet, you can use the following pointers to begin narrowing down your options. As you probably are aware, there are a large number of nursing schools and colleges near Lawrence KS as well as within Kansas and throughout the United States. So it is necessary to lower the number of schools to select from so that you will have a workable list. As we previously mentioned, the location of the school as well as the expense of tuition are undoubtedly going to be the primary two things that you will consider. But as we also emphasized, they should not be your only qualifiers. So prior to making your ultimate selection, use the following questions to evaluate how your selection measures up to the other schools.

  • Accreditation. It's a good idea to make sure that the certificate or degree program in addition to the school are accredited by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ged accrediting agency. Besides helping verify that you obtain a premium education, it may help in obtaining financial aid or student loans, which are often not offered for non-accredited schools near Lawrence KS.
  • Licensing Preparation. Licensing criteria for LPNs and LVNs vary from state to state. In all states, a passing score is needed on the National Council Licensure Examination (NCLEX-PN) in addition to graduation from an accredited school. Many states require a specific number of clinical hours be completed, as well as the passing of additional tests. It's essential that the school you are attending not only delivers an outstanding education, but also prepares you to satisfy the minimum licensing standards for Kansas or the state where you will be working.
  • Reputation. Look at internet rating services to see what the reviews are for each of the LPN or LVN schools you are considering. Ask the accrediting organizations for their reviews as well. Also, get in touch with the Kansas school licensing authority to check out if there are any complaints or compliance issues. Finally, you can contact some local Lawrence KS healthcare organizations you're interested in working for after graduation and ask what their assessments are of the schools as well.
  • Graduation and Job Placement Rates. Find out from the LPN or LVN programs you are considering what their graduation rates are as well as how long on average it takes students to finish their programs. A low graduation rate may be an indication that students were dissatisfied with the program and dropped out. It's also imperative that the schools have high job placement rates. A high rate will not only substantiate that the school has a good reputation within the Lawrence KS healthcare community, but that it also has the network of relationships to assist students obtain employment.
  • Internship Programs. The most ideal way to get experience as a Licensed Practical Nurse is to work in a clinical environment. Virtually all nursing degree programs require a specific number of clinical hours be completed. A number of states have minimum clinical hour requirements for licensing too. Check if the schools have a working relationship with nearby Lawrence KS community hospitals, clinics or labs and assist with the placing of students in internships.
